Black + Blum, taking inspiration from the architectural structure has come up with the latest house ware products-High & Dry dish rack. Somewhat sharing qualities with the Quadracci Pavilion, Santiago’s 2001 addition to the Milwaukee Art Museum, these good-looking dish racks is unquestionably pleasing to eye. The wave of spires that are able to hold champagne flutes, the drainage tray with flip up spout to hold a range of kitchen set-ups offers a cool way of organizing your dishes. And yes, it’s completely recyclable which speaks out for it being an eco-friend.
